Difference between revisions of "Porting Guide"

From WebOS-Ports
Jump to navigation Jump to search
(Created page with "= Kernel configuration = We need the following kernel options: <code> CONFIG_ANDROID=y CONFIG_ANDROID_BINDER_IPC=y CONFIG_ANDROID_LOGGER=y CONFIG_ANDROID_PARANOID_NETWORK=n...")
 
Line 3: Line 3:
 
We need the following kernel options:
 
We need the following kernel options:
  
<code>
+
* CONFIG_ANDROID=y
CONFIG_ANDROID=y
+
* CONFIG_ANDROID_BINDER_IPC=y
CONFIG_ANDROID_BINDER_IPC=y
+
* CONFIG_ANDROID_LOGGER=y
CONFIG_ANDROID_LOGGER=y
 
  
CONFIG_ANDROID_PARANOID_NETWORK=n
+
* CONFIG_ANDROID_PARANOID_NETWORK=n
CONFIG_HAS_WAKELOCK=n
+
* CONFIG_HAS_WAKELOCK=n
CONFIG_HAS_EARLYSUSPEND=n
+
* CONFIG_HAS_EARLYSUSPEND=n
CONFIG_WAKELOCK=n
+
* CONFIG_WAKELOCK=n
CONFIG_WAKELOCK_STAT=n
+
* CONFIG_WAKELOCK_STAT=n
CONFIG_USER_WAKELOCK=n
+
* CONFIG_USER_WAKELOCK=n
  
CONFIG_SYSVIPC=y
+
* CONFIG_SYSVIPC=y
CONFIG_DEVTMPFS=y
+
* CONFIG_DEVTMPFS=y
CONFIG_DEVPTS_MULTIPLE_INSTANCES=y
+
* CONFIG_DEVPTS_MULTIPLE_INSTANCES=y
CONFIG_FSNOTIFY=y
+
* CONFIG_FSNOTIFY=y
CONFIG_DNOTIFY=y
+
* CONFIG_DNOTIFY=y
CONFIG_INOTIFY_USER=y
+
* CONFIG_INOTIFY_USER=y
CONFIG_FANOTIFY=y
+
* CONFIG_FANOTIFY=y
CONFIG_FANOTIFY_ACCESS_PERMISSIONS=y
+
* CONFIG_FANOTIFY_ACCESS_PERMISSIONS=y
CONFIG_SWAP=y
+
* CONFIG_SWAP=y
</code>
 

Revision as of 12:25, 16 May 2013

Kernel configuration

We need the following kernel options:

  • CONFIG_ANDROID=y
  • CONFIG_ANDROID_BINDER_IPC=y
  • CONFIG_ANDROID_LOGGER=y
  • CONFIG_ANDROID_PARANOID_NETWORK=n
  • CONFIG_HAS_WAKELOCK=n
  • CONFIG_HAS_EARLYSUSPEND=n
  • CONFIG_WAKELOCK=n
  • CONFIG_WAKELOCK_STAT=n
  • CONFIG_USER_WAKELOCK=n
  • CONFIG_SYSVIPC=y
  • CONFIG_DEVTMPFS=y
  • CONFIG_DEVPTS_MULTIPLE_INSTANCES=y
  • CONFIG_FSNOTIFY=y
  • CONFIG_DNOTIFY=y
  • CONFIG_INOTIFY_USER=y
  • CONFIG_FANOTIFY=y
  • CONFIG_FANOTIFY_ACCESS_PERMISSIONS=y
  • CONFIG_SWAP=y